Why a Jar of Pickles Became an Unforgettable Memory!

Posted on November 19, 2025 By Aga Co No Comments on Why a Jar of Pickles Became an Unforgettable Memory!

It all began on a normal evening—the kind where nothing seems special until life hands you a memory you’ll carry forever. My wife was deep into her pregnancy, and anyone who’s been there knows cravings are unpredictable. They strike out of nowhere, hit like a freight train, and suddenly the universe revolves around satisfying them. That night, her focus was on one very specific thing: McDonald’s pickles.

Not the burgers. Not the fries. Just the pickles. The craving was so strong and so exact that she looked at me with the seriousness usually reserved for emergencies. I didn’t question it. When a pregnant woman needs something, there’s no negotiation—you move. I grabbed my keys and headed out, determined to bring back whatever her heart—and hormones—demanded.

The nearest McDonald’s wasn’t far, but the drive felt like a mission. What if they were out of pickles? What if they refused? What if I came back empty-handed while she imagined the taste of those briny slices? That scenario wasn’t an option.

When I arrived, the restaurant was quiet, that late-night hush of fast-food places: a few customers, the hiss of the fryer, and tired employees waiting for the clock to run out. I stepped up to the counter and asked, politely and clearly, if I could buy just a container of pickles.

The cashier blinked, unsure she’d heard me correctly. “Sorry,” she said. “We can’t sell pickles alone. Company policy.”

Most people would’ve left it there. But I had a pregnant woman at home whose entire emotional stability depended on McDonald’s pickles. I couldn’t walk out. So I leaned in, half joking, half desperate: “Alright, then. Give me one hundred hamburgers with extra pickles, hold everything else.”

The cashier froze, then looked toward the kitchen like she needed backup. She disappeared, probably assuming I’d lost my mind or was pulling a stunt.

A moment later, the manager appeared—a man in his thirties, looking like he’d seen every type of customer and wasn’t easily rattled. I explained everything simply: “My wife is pregnant. She’s craving McDonald’s pickles. I just don’t want to go home empty-handed.”

He didn’t laugh. He didn’t brush me off. He didn’t cite corporate rules. He paused, took a slow breath, and nodded, like he understood exactly what was at stake. Then he went into the back.

I waited, wondering what would happen. Would he say no? Call security? Build one hundred deconstructed burgers? After a few minutes, he returned holding a large container, full to the brim with fresh McDonald’s pickles.

“No charge,” he said. “Take these to your wife.”

No forms. No judgment. Just kindness.

I thanked him over and over, then carried that container home like treasure. When my wife saw it, her face lit up with a mix of gratitude, amusement, and relief. She opened it immediately, and the joy was contagious. It wasn’t really about the pickles—it was about feeling seen, supported, and loved amid the chaos of pregnancy.

That night, we sat together as she happily ate pickles straight from the bucket. Somewhere between her laughter and the crunch of those slices, I realized this simple act had become something bigger than a craving.

It became a reminder: of what it means to love someone enough to run into the night to get them what they need, even if it seems silly. A reminder that small acts of understanding matter, especially when life feels out of control. And a reminder that strangers, even at the end of a long shift, can choose compassion in unexpected ways.

The manager didn’t just bend a rule. He didn’t just give me pickles. He made a memory—a story we’ll one day tell our child about how a craving, an awkward request, and a stranger’s kindness turned a normal night into something unforgettable.

The pickles were gone in less than a week. The memory will last forever.
